The hiring process consist of one round of written test and two rounds of technical face to face interview and then lastly HR interview. This is a normal process of any of 1-7 yrs exp.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Written test is composed of technical/ programming language skills like Java,C,C++,SQL.
F2F round was bit difficult (especially for fresher) Questions asked on Data structure, Algorithms, gave a problem on RDBMS and asked to write SQL query.
I applied through college or university.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at Persistent Systems (Calcutta)
Interview
They came for campus interview to kolkata. There was following rounds:
1. A 1 hr written test which was having two sections. 1st section multiple choice from all the major CS subjects like DS, Algo, Database, Networking, Operation systems etc. In the 2nd section there was two programs to be written.
2. On a separate day they published the selected candidates and asked for a F2F round.
3. On the day, there was two F2F interviews each of 2 hours on CS concepts followed by a basic HR round.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Reverse a sentence by word with a given reverse function
